I've known the boat since it was new. It was and still is a great boat. This boat will go through anything. The 1075's are what they are, some love them, some hate them. Bottom line is You are getting a good turnkey boat with 50K worth of drives, and another 70-90K worth of motors if you chose to part it out and put what you want in it. Don't compare it to a 1350 boat, because for that price you can't even buy the power. It is what it is, a competitively priced Bad ASs used boat.
